Voyager Brake Control Wiring Diagram for Installation in a 2005 Chevrolet 1500 Silverado  

Question:

I have the Tekonsha Voyager Brake Control and want to put it in my 2005 Chevy Silverado 1500. Chevy supplies the z82 glove box jumper, it has 5 wres Dk Blue - Trailer Brake Controller Switched Output Red - Fused Trailer Brake Controller Battery Feed Blk - Brake Controller Ground Lt Blu - Vehicle Stop Lamp Switch to Brake Controller Input BRN - Brake Controller Illumination Could you tell me exactly how to connect the wires from this plug to the Voyager BLK, White, Blue, Red so I know that part of the Installation is correct?

Expert Reply:

The connections you will need to make to install your Voyager brake controller are listed below. If your Voyager has a connector attached to the wires at the back you can use the Pigtail Wiring Harness, # 7894, to connect to the wires on the connector supplied by GM that is similar to the # 3015-S connector we carry. If you wanted a complete harness without splicing you could use the plug-in wiring adapter, # 3015-P. I have added a photo of the connector for the 2005 Chevrolet Silverado with the wiring labeled also.

Dk Blue - Trailer Brake Controller Switched Output - To blue output wire from brake controller
Red - Fused Trailer Brake Controller Battery Feed - To black wire from brake controller.
Blk - Brake Controller Ground - To white wire from brake controller.
Lt Blu - Vehicle Stop Lamp Switch to Brake Controller Input - To red wire from brake controller.
BRN - Brake Controller Illumination - Not used.
